STOCK MARKET
WHAKATANE SALE The New Zealand Loan and Mercantile Agency Co. 11. report it good, yarding tit the Wlmkatane saleyards, where all classes ol' cattle .sold freely and with a sharp rise in value. Fat Jersey cows made up to £7 16s and heavy boners from f>s to £Tj 15s, while a pen of :j-year Jersey steers realised £8 2s (id. Potter bulls were in demand and made up to £10 7s 6d. A total clearance wns ■^effected.
